Mrs. Sandorse presented her=petition-'for variance relief, at-Map 228, Lot749 Katherine Road, ,,Centerville in an RC zoning districtrfor a lot containing 10,500 square feet that the petitioner purchased three years ago., The. petitioner purchased her residence twelve- years ago which is contiguous with this lot - both parcels are solely. in her name. :,When the petitioner-'purchased' this lot, it was to the best of her knowledge; `a buildable lot. The lots on either side are of -comparable size and have homesriconstructed ou_them. Mrs. Sandorse would like to. construct a single-family, residenCe on this lot. Ldke Lally found that variance conditions do exist, simply b,epause_ of the fact that the lot is located among lots of similar s•ize.''. He also found that three years ago it was a buildable lot, because -the deed put-this into single ownership ,and changed-'the legality-of whether a house could be ,built• on it or not, is to may,way of thinking not "important, and since no one spoke,.in opposition to the petition, I make a,motion based on these findings to' .grant, the ,,petitioner the relief .sought ,'- the motion`.was seconded. by Dexter Bliss. - Helen Wirtanen, Gail Nightingale and. Dexter Bliss found that the petitionerfailed to establish variance conditions' as defined in Section 10, of Chapter 4OA, M.G.L.; and ,th'e petitioner has created her own hardship.
